Important pretext that our office is due to move in around 6 months. Our office feels spacious and has all the basic trimmings one would expect, however it is starting to feel a little bit tired especially when compared to some of the new buildings coming up in the city. The location, up near K' road is central but has unfortunately been affected by the increase in central city crime, drug and alcohol issues. There have been a few cases of people being put in uncomfortable situations by people with mental health issues or under the influence of alcohol or drugs. People are looking forward to our move down to Wynyard corner. The facilities are well cared for, end of trip facilities include bike parking and electric bike/scooter charging along with showers and a drying room. The office always feels clean and tidy which is a big plus. The dress code is fairly loose, on a regular day I wear chinos or blue jeans and a dress shirt and a sweater with either chelsea boots or Doc martins. On a Friday I wear more casual clothes such as a t-shirt. I have never had anyone mention my clothes.
